WebAug 11, 2024 · A water leak that appears to be coming from beneath the washing machine, usually a large amount of water, is frequently caused by one of the many hoses inside the washer, most commonly the tub-to-pump hose. The dispenser hose and the internal drain hose are two other hoses to inspect.

Turn the pump filter counterclockwise and remove the filter. Open slowly to allow the water to drain. Clean the debris from the filter. Replace the filter and turn clockwise. Tighten securely.
